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Metabase
- AI Service charges $3.75 per 1 million tokens (after 1M free tokens included)
- Transforms cost $0.01 per run after 1,000 included runs per month
- Advanced Transforms cost $0.02 per run after included allocation
- Storage overages start at $2 per 1M rows (1M rows free)
- All yearly plans offer 10% discount versus monthly, incentivizing annual commitment
Strapi
- Cloud pricing is per project, not per account, so a second project doubles the bill
- Starter at $35 a month allows 100,000 API requests, and overage is $1.50 per 25,000
- Extra bandwidth is $30 per 100 GB and extra asset storage $0.60 per GB
- Backups start at the Pro plan, weekly, and only become daily at Business
- An uptime SLA is Business only, at $450 a month per project
- Additional environments cost $60 a month on Pro and $300 a month on Business

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Metabase: How much does Metabase cost?
Metabase Open Source is free for self-hosted deployments with unlimited users and dashboards. Cloud-hosted Starter tier costs $90/month annually ($100/month monthly) with Pro at $517.50/month annually ($575/month monthly). Enterprise plans start at $20,000 per year.
SourceStrapi: How much do API request overages cost?
Additional API requests beyond the plan limit cost $1.50 per 25000 requests. Extra asset storage costs $0.60 per GB, and additional bandwidth costs $30 per 100 GB.
SourceMetabase: Does Metabase charge for additional users?
Yes, Metabase charges per-user fees beyond included users. Starter includes 5 users at $6 per additional user per month. Pro includes 10 users at $12 per additional user per month. Enterprise pricing is custom.
SourceStrapi: Is yearly billing available?
Yes, yearly billing saves up to 17% compared to monthly billing on Strapi Cloud plans.
SourceMetabase: What usage-based fees does Metabase charge?
Metabase charges $3.75 per 1 million tokens for AI services (after 1M free tokens), $0.01 per transform run after 1,000 included per month, $0.02 for advanced transforms, and storage overages at $2 per 1M rows beyond the included 1M rows.
SourceStrapi: What is included with the Pro plan?
The Pro plan costs $90 per month per project and includes 1M API requests, 250 GB asset storage, 500 GB bandwidth, multi-environment support, weekly backups, and manual backups.
